1 SDReaderCE An Overview on Use and Functionality

2 Using SDReaderCE After loading the route to the handheld from SDReader6, select the route folder from file list on the handheld Select the route to be read and click OK

3 Using SDReaderCE To manually enter reads, type in the reads on the handheld’s number pad and hit enter This will send the reading into the database and progress to the next customer

4 Using SDReaderCE SDReaderCE has the ability to do so much more than visual reading It can read touch and radio meters To configure the AMR settings, click on the Options Button This will bring up the options window Click on AMR Options which brings up the AMR Options menu Click Enable AMR. This enables the AMR Device and Set AMR Background options Click on AMR Device

7 Using SDReaderCE Another useful feature of the SDReaderCE system is the searching function Searches are based on the selected access keys To switch access keys, simply press Ctrl + A, or hit the circle with the stylus Searches can be performed on Route Sequence Number On Customer Name On Location And on Meter ID

8 Using SDReaderCE To start the search, Click on the Search button The search is being conducted on the Route Sequence Key in this example A dialog box will appear with a place to enter in the Route Sequence Key to be found Enter the desired Route Sequence number (0100010 in this instance) and press Go The screen will show the account with the corresponding Route Sequence number

9 Using SDReaderCE SDReaderCE allows for communication between the billing administration and meter readers Messages to the meter reader are always visible in the message box Notes to the billing administration by the meter reader are made by clicking the Attach Note button The Attach Note window will pop up Type in the note or choose a canned note from the Select From List option Click Save to save the note

10 Using SDReaderCE SDReaderCE also allows the reader to only view accounts that have not been read Simply click the Unreads button to view only unread meter accounts

11 Using SDReaderCE The most exciting feature of the SDReaderCE program is its mapping capabilities To view the map, click on the mapping button As the meter reader progresses through the route, the meter points disappear as they are read The meter reader can see the details of each account represented on the map by circling its dot with the stylus A Dialog will pop up giving the address of the selected account Press Go to go to the account information page

12 Using SDReaderCE If any shortcuts are forgotten or any help is needed, a list of features and shortcuts is available through the options menu Select Hot Keys in the dropdown menu The list of features and their shortcuts comes up Press any key to escape back to the program

13 Using SDReaderCE When replacing a meter in the field, enter the old meters reading as normal and then click the options button and highlight Meter Change Out when the account to be changed is on the screen The Meter Change Out form will pop up Enter the new meter ID and the new meter’s reading If applicable, enter the GPS coordinates or get them from the Bluetooth receiver Choose Save to save the meter change out information

15 Using SDReaderCE SDReaderCE has the ability to wirelessly connect to a GPS device that sends position coordinates to the handheld To connect to the GPS device, select GPS Options from the options menu From the GPS Options menu, select GPS Receiver and then select Configuration from the following menu The GPS Receiver Selection page pops up Click Discover Devices to find Bluetooth GPS devices in range Highlight the receiver that shows up and click Test Connection Click Save after it is done testing the connection

17 Using SDReaderCE To connect the handheld to the Bluetooth GPS Receiver, select GPS Options, then GPS Receiver and then Connect Once the GPS Receiver is connected, the Latitude and Longitude coordinates show up at the bottom of the screen

18 Using SDReaderCE The location of meter points on the map can be re- assigned with the coordinates on the GPS Receiver To re-assign the meter point on the map, stand over the meter and press CTRL + G while showing the account that you want to re-plot. In this case it is Linnie Hart The mapping icon will change to green and red and the letters GPS will appear to the right of the route sequence number to show that the GPS coordinates have been re-plotted GPS

20 Smart Phone SDReaderCE is not confined to handheld computers, it is also operational on Windows Mobile smart phones The functionality is exactly the same with a few additions Routes can be uploaded and downloaded via the internet In SDReader6 in the Device window, select Internet Build the download file as normal and then select the correct device ID and route map and click Copy to read device

21 Smart Phone On the smart phone, click the information button and select Manage Web Routes Choose Get Web Routes to download the route into the smart phone Select the appropriate route from the left column Once selected, the route name will move to the right column Click Download to copy the route to the phone The downloaded route will then be ready to commence with reading When finished reading the route, click the information button and select Post Web Route This will automatically upload the route to the internet Routes can be downloaded for free of charge at any wifi hotspot or anywhere at all with a paid data connection from any cell phone company that provides Windows Mobile smartphones

22 Smart Phone The GPS coordinate plotting has also gained more functionality that is only available on devices running Windows Mobile 5.0 or higher The Low Performance GPS (LPGPS) functionality remains unchanged LPGPS functionality is included in the basic package and has an accuracy to within 10 - 15 meters The only extra needed is a Bluetooth receiver to connect to the GPS satellites

23 Smart Phone For High Performance GPS (HPGPS), SDReaderCE utilizes the Trimble system The Trimble receiver and libraries can receive and calculate meter points with real time sub-meter accuracy With post processing, the plotted points will be accurate to within 4 inches This accuracy is achieved by a combination of multiple satellite technology and advanced algorithms that calculate the satellite information that is received The receiver (pictured below to the right) is powered by a replaceable, rechargeable battery that lasts a whole day on a full charge As with the LPGPS, the points are plotted on a map custom made by SDI
